Skip to content

Commit eb94846

Browse files
committed
qxl: fix pre-save logic
Oops. Logic is backwards. Fixes: 39b8a18 ("qxl: remove assert in qxl_pre_save.") Resolves: https://gitlab.com/qemu-project/qemu/-/issues/610 Resolves: https://bugzilla.redhat.com//show_bug.cgi?id=2002907 Signed-off-by: Gerd Hoffmann <[email protected]> Reviewed-by: Daniel P. Berrangé <[email protected]> Reviewed-by: Marc-André Lureau <[email protected]> Message-Id: <[email protected]>
1 parent 831aaf2 commit eb94846

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

hw/display/qxl.c

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2252,7 +2252,7 @@ static int qxl_pre_save(void *opaque)
22522252
} else {
22532253
d->last_release_offset = (uint8_t *)d->last_release - ram_start;
22542254
}
2255-
if (d->last_release_offset < d->vga.vram_size) {
2255+
if (d->last_release_offset >= d->vga.vram_size) {
22562256
return 1;
22572257
}
22582258

0 commit comments

Comments
 (0)